1) He will remain in South Korea for the OSL Prelims; he will be returning to Andrew's house when he comes back -- this means he will NOT be staying in Korea to compete past (I assume) July. 2) He's stated many times he favors foreign teams over Korean teams (to join, at least). This means you can count on a foreign team to pick him up as he doesn't favor the Korean practice schedules/playstyles (as he's said before in interviews). Anything else, Andrew will be sure to update you guys on. Please take note of Andrew's post that there is no conflict between viOLet and the team -- this is all simply due to contracts expiring etc. and is the norm -- nothing hairy or bad going on here. | ||
